电子产品设计案例教程(微课版)-基于嘉立创EDA(专业版) 课件 第13章 复用图块_第1页
电子产品设计案例教程(微课版)-基于嘉立创EDA(专业版) 课件 第13章 复用图块_第2页
电子产品设计案例教程(微课版)-基于嘉立创EDA(专业版) 课件 第13章 复用图块_第3页
电子产品设计案例教程(微课版)-基于嘉立创EDA(专业版) 课件 第13章 复用图块_第4页
电子产品设计案例教程(微课版)-基于嘉立创EDA(专业版) 课件 第13章 复用图块_第5页
已阅读5页,还剩39页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

第13章复用图块任务描述

常规原理图设计是将整个原理图绘制在一张原理图纸上,这种设计方法对小规模,简单的电路图的较为适合。当设计大规模,复杂的电路图时,整个原理图绘制在一张图纸上,就会使图纸尺寸变得很大,内容紧凑,可读性差,不利于电路的分析。嘉立创EDA(专业版)支持复用图块(层次原理图设计)功能,此时可以采用复用图块(层次原理图设计)来简化电路,使电路的各个功能部分更加清晰,增强电路图的可读性。51单片机开发板电路的复用图块(层次原理图设计)51单片机开发板电路的PCB设计13.1复用图块介绍复用图块分为顶层图块符号和底层复用工程两个部分,顶层图块符号,类型流程图,而底层复用工程是实际的模块电路图。即一个顶层图块符号对应一个底层复用工程。顶层图块符号页不能放置元器件,需通过放置引脚来与底层原理图相连接;底层原理图通过网络端口生成顶层图块符号的引脚。底层网络端口与顶层图块符号引脚相对应,且必须同名,在电气上是相互连接的。13.1复用图块介绍

复用图块设计方法可以分为两种:自顶向下和自底向上设计方法。自顶向下的设计方法是先设计顶层图块符号,再根据顶层图块符号生成底层原理图端口。自底向上的设计方法是先在底层原理图中设计电路以及规划端口,再生成一个顶层图块符号。13.2新建复用图块

在顶部菜单栏执行“文件”→“新建”→“复用图块”命令,弹出“新建复用图块”窗口,填写复用图块的名称,管理分类,描述等信息,点击“保存”按钮,完成创建,如图13-3所示。图13-3新建复用图块信息13.2新建复用图块单击“保存”按钮后,系统会自动生成一个复用工程,底层原理图与顶层图块符号相互关联,如图13-4所示。在复用工程的原理图页上进行底层原理图绘制,使用顶层图块进行复用。图13-4复用工程与图块符号13.351单片机开发板的复用图块(层次原理图设计)从功能上可以将51单片机开发板电路板分为单片机模块、混合电路模块、计时器模块、接口模块、数码管显示模块和USB转串口模块6部分。下面使用复用图块来设计实现51单片机开发板电路图的绘制。图13-551单片机开发板电路原理图(图纸尺寸A3)13.351单片机开发板的复用图块(层次原理图设计)通过51单片机开发板为实例,如图13-5所示,介绍使用嘉立创(专业版)进行复用图块设计的方法。虽然电路不是特别复杂,不使用复用图块设计也可以完成PCB板的设计,但还是以它为例,来介绍复用图块设计的方法。图13-551单片机开发板电路原理图(图纸尺寸A3)13.3.1自顶向下的复用图块设计

(1)新建工程在顶部菜单栏执行“文件”→“新建”→“工程”命令,弹出“新建工程”窗口,填写工程名称等信息,点击“保存”按钮,完成创建,工程列表详情如图13-8所示。图13-8工程列表13.3.1自顶向下的复用图块设计

(1)新建工程在51单片机开发板工程下原理图页使用复用图块设计,类似系统框图的形式进行绘制。将Schematic1命名修改为系统框图,P1图页修改为SCH_BlockDiagram,PCB1修改为51单片机开发板,如图13-9所示。图13-9修改工程列表信息13.3.1自顶向下的复用图块设计

(2)工程绘制在SCH_BlockDiagram图页里面,绘制单片机模块、混合电路模块、计时器模块、接口电路模块、数码管显示模块和USB转串口模块6部分的复用图块。在顶部菜单执行“放置”→“复用图块”命令,绘制一个方块图,单击鼠标左键会弹出“新建复用图块”窗口,在此窗口中填写复用图块的名称描述等信息,点击“保存”按钮,完成复用图块的新建与放置,如图13-12所示。图13-12单片机模块复用图块13.3.1自顶向下的复用图块设计这种方法创建的复用图块只存在当前工程库中,而上文点击文件创建的复用图块存在于个人库中,在不同的工程需要复用时,可在底部菜单栏里选择放置即可,如图13-13所示。图13-13使用底部菜单栏放置复用图块13.3.1自顶向下的复用图块设计选中单片机模块,右键点击展开,会自动跳转到单片机模块的底层原理图页面中,在此图页绘制实际的单片机模块电路。点击编辑图块符号,会自动跳转到顶层图块符号编辑页中,在此页面中可以修改图块的形状样式,与元器件的符号编辑页相似,不能放置元器件,只能放置引脚,如图13-14所示。图13-14复用图块右键信息菜单栏13.3.1自顶向下的复用图块设计单片机模块底层原理图页,如图13-15所示,顶层图块符号编辑页,如图13-16所示。图13-15单片机模块底层原理图页图13-16单片机模块顶层图块符号编辑页13.3.1自顶向下的复用图块设计1)自顶向下的复用图块设计这里用户使用自顶向下的复用图块设计方法来绘制USB转串口模块,根据图13-551单片机开发板原理图所示,可以发现CH340C与单片机的P30/P31引脚相连接,所以在图块符号中放置P30/P31引脚和VCC/GND引脚,放置USBtoTTL字符注释,如图13-17所示。图13-17USB转串口模块顶层图块符号绘制13.3.1自顶向下的复用图块设计1)自顶向下的复用图块设计完成顶层图块符号绘制保存后,在顶部菜单执行“设计”→“生成/更新图块原理图”命令,如图13-18所示,或点击顶部工具栏的“生成/更新图块原理图”操作生成底层原理图端口,如图13-19所示。图13-18通过顶部菜单栏操作图块符号生成更新底层原理图端口13.3.1自顶向下的复用图块设计1)自顶向下的复用图块设计完成顶层图块符号绘制保存后,在顶部菜单执行“设计”→“生成/更新图块原理图”命令,如图13-18所示,或点击顶部工具栏的“生成/更新图块原理图”操作生成底层原理图端口,如图13-19所示。图13-19通过顶部工具栏操作图块符号生成更新底层原理图端口13.3.1自顶向下的复用图块设计点击“生成/更新图块原理图”后会自动跳转到底层原理图页中,并弹出提示“检测到原理图的网络端口和复用图块的引脚不同步,是否更新网络端口?”点击是即可同步生成与图块符号的引脚一致的网络端口,如图13-20所示。底层网络端口生成,如图13-21所示。图13-21底层网络端口生成图13-20底层原理图网络端口和顶层图块符号引脚是否同步弹窗13.3.1自顶向下的复用图块设计同理,可以绘制计时器模块复用图块,NE555的OUT引脚通过使用短路帽与2.54mm排针短接后与单片机的P35引脚相连接。3.3V与接口电路相连接,所以在图块符号中放置P35/3V3/VCC/GND引脚,放置Timer字符注释,如图13-22所示。图13-22计时器模块顶层图块符号绘制13.3.1自顶向下的复用图块设计根据51单片机开发板原理图做参考,将TYPE-C,TYPE-B,电源自锁开关,电源指示灯和CH340C部分绘制到USB转串口模块底层原理图中,完成USB转串口模块复用图块的绘制,如图13-23所示。图13-23USB转串口模块底层原理图13.3.1自顶向下的复用图块设计将NE555与LM1117-3.3部分绘制到计时器电路模块底层原理图中,完成计时器模块复用图块的绘制,如图13-24所示。图13-24计时器模块底层原理图13.3.2自底向上的复用图块设计

使用自底向上的复用图块设计方法来演示绘制接口电路模块,根据图13-551单片机开发板原理图所示,可以发现接口电路模块里有多组并行的导线,引入总线来进行绘制,减少连线的数量和复杂度。总线可以表示为一组并行的导线,是信号线集合,总线命名必须符合NET[x:y]规范才能使用。13.3.2自底向上的复用图块设计可以在顶部菜单栏上执行“放置”→“总线”命令,或在顶部工具栏点击“总线”图标进行绘制放置总线,导线与总线连接端出现一个BusEntry(总线入口符号)时,代表成功连接上总线,成为总线分支,通过总线拉出的导线的顺序是按照总线命名的名称来排序放置的,拉出导线名称超过y时会重新从x开始排序,如图13-28所示。图13-28总线内容介绍13.3.2自底向上的复用图块设计通过总线连接出的网络端口命名必须与总线命名保持一致,如图13-29所示。用户将单片机外接排针接口,3V3/VCC/GND排针接口,LCD1602和LCD12232液晶显示模块接口绘制到接口电路复用图块的底层原理图中。将P00~P07、P10~P17、P20~P27、P30~P37引脚通过总线的形式用网络端口引出,3V3/VCC/GND也使用端口引出,如图13-30所示。图13-29网络端口与总线命名需保持一致图13-30引脚通过总线的形式用网络端口引出13.3.2自底向上的复用图块设计完成接口电路模块底层原理图的绘制,如图13-31所示。在顶部菜单执行“设计”→“生成/更新图块符号”命令,如图13-32所示。图13-31接口电路模块底层原理图图13-32通过顶部菜单栏操作底层原理图生成更新图块符号引脚13.3.2自底向上的复用图块设计在顶部工具栏点击“生成/更新图块符号”图标,如图13-33所示,对应生成顶层图块符号引脚,放置Interface字符注释,如图13-34所示。图13-33工具栏操作底层原理图生成更新图块符号引脚图13-34接口电路模块顶层图块符号绘制13.3.2自底向上的复用图块设计同理,可以绘制数码管显示模块和混合电路模块的复用图块,数码管显示模块底层原理图将P00~P07和P20~P23引脚通过P0[0:7]和P2[0:3]总线形式用网络端口引出,VCC也使用端口引出,完成数码管显示模块底层原理图的绘制,如图13-35所示。对应生成顶层图块符号引脚,放置DigitalDisplay字符注释,如图13-36所示。图13-35数码管显示模块底层原理图图13-36数码管显示电路模块顶层图块符号绘制13.3.2自底向上的复用图块设计混合电路模块底层原理图将P32~P37引脚通过P3[2:7]总线形式用网络端口引出,P10/VCC/GND也使用端口引出,完成混合电路模块底层原理图的绘制,如图13-37所示。对应生成顶层图块符号引脚,放置HybridCircuit字符注释,如图13-38所示。图13-37混合电路模块底层原理图图13-38混合电路模块顶层图块符号绘制13.3.2自底向上的复用图块设计

完成了外围模块设计后,到了单片机模块复用图块的设计,根据图13-551单片机开发板原理图所示,用户将STC89C52主控芯片、复位电路、晶振电路等部分绘制在单片机模块复用电路的底层原理图中,将P00~P07、P10~P17、P20~P27、P30~P37、P20~P23、P32~P37引脚通过P0[0:7]、P1[0:7]、P2[0:7]、P3[0:7]、P2[0:3]、P3[2:7]总线形式用网络端口引出,P10/P30/P31/P35和VCC/GND也使用端口引出,完成单片机模块底层原理图的绘制,如图13-39所示。对应生成顶层图块符号引脚,放置MCU字符注释,如图13-40所示。图13-39单片机模块底层原理图图13-40单片机模块顶层图块符号绘制13.3.2自底向上的复用图块设计这里,用户使用自顶向下的复用图块设计方法完成USB转串口模块和计时器模块的绘制,使用自底向上的复用图块设计方法完成接口电路模块、数码管显示电路模块、混合电路模块和单片机模块的绘制。13.4系统框图

完成各个模块电路的设计后,到了顶层原理图的绘制,放置各个模块电路复用图块,进行连线绘制,复用图块的总线引脚需采用总线进行连接,如图13-41所示。图13-41系统框图13.551单片机开发板的PCB设计在这个工程中用户不需要使用到复用图块的PCB功能,所以完成了51单片机开发板的整体原理图设计后,可以将没用的复用工程PCB删除掉,简洁工程列表如图13-42所示。图13-42简洁工程列表13.551单片机开发板的PCB设计完成工程原理图绘制后,在顶部菜单执行“设计”→“更新/转换原理图到PCB”命令,会自动跳转到工程PCB界面并弹出“确认导入信息”窗口,如图13-44所示,点击“应用修改”按钮,完成将原理图信息转入PCB的工作,如图13-45所示。图13-45元器件PCB导入图图13-44PCB“确认导入信息”弹窗13.551单片机开发板的PCB设计绘制一个100×100mm大小的矩形板框,可按Tab键切换输入框的值,回车(Enter)确定,生成板框。板四周为直角容易扎伤人,这里点中板框,在右侧属性面板中为板框添加5mm半径的圆角,如图13-47所示。图13-47为板框添加圆角13.551单片机开发板的PCB设计绘制完板框后,开始进行器件的布局,这里四个M3大小的安装定位孔摆放在板边四周,USB放置在板左下侧边缘,电源开关紧挨USB放置,单片机摆放在右边中部,数码管摆放在板右上方边缘,按键排列在单片机下方靠板边缘放置,各外接排针接口靠板边放置,可以参考布局,如图13-48所示。图13-4851单片机开发板参考布局图13.551单片机开发板的PCB设计完成器件布局后,进行PCB的布线,这里电源线宽设置为25mil,普通信号线宽为15mil。在走线时优先走直线,需要拐角的地方尽量用钝角或者圆弧为主。尽量避免锐角和直角的出现,以免产生不必要的辐射干扰。在“顶部菜单栏”可点击“布线”,显示出布线功能列表,如图13-49所示。在顶部工具栏点击“单路布线”按钮进行布线操作,如图13-50所示。图13-50顶部工具栏单路布线操作图13-49布线功能列表13.551单片机开发板的PCB设计完成布局布线后,可使用铺铜对GND进行连接,可通过顶部菜单栏“放置”→“铺铜区域”,如图13-51所示,或顶部工具栏的“铺铜区域”绘制铺铜,如图1

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论